Trisomy 18 (Edwards Syndrome) Support Groups Online ...

    https://www.dailystrength.org/group/trisomy-18-edwards-syndrome
    Trisomy 18 (Edwards Syndrome) Support Group. Trisomy 18 or Edwards Syndrome is a genetic disorder. Edwards Syndrome can result in characteristic physical abnormalities and significant developmental delays. For this reason a full-term Edwards syndrome baby may exhibit the breathing and feeding difficulties of a premature baby.

Trisomy 18 - Genetics Home Reference - NIH

    https://ghr.nlm.nih.gov/condition/trisomy-18
    Oct 29, 2019 · Trisomy 18 occurs in about 1 in 5,000 live-born infants; it is more common in pregnancy, but many affected fetuses do not survive to term. Although women of all ages can have a child with trisomy 18, the chance of having a child with this condition increases as a woman gets older.
